Description

Stretching is a common practice among athletes and fitness enthusiasts, but it can also be a great way to start your day. Morning stretching can help improve flexibility, reduce tension and stiffness, and increase blood flow to your muscles. But can it also wake you up and give you a burst of energy? The answer is yes! Stretching can help stimulate your nervous system, increase circulation, and release endorphins, which are natural mood-boosting chemicals in the brain. This can help you feel more awake and alert, and ready to take on whatever challenges the day may bring.

How to Stretch in the Morning

Stretching in the morning doesn't have to be complicated or time-consuming. You can start with some simple stretches that target your major muscle groups, such as your back, legs, arms, and neck. You can also incorporate some yoga poses or Pilates moves to help improve your balance and flexibility. The key is to choose stretches that feel good and that you enjoy doing, so that you're more likely to stick with it.

Here are some examples of stretches to try:

  • Forward fold: Stand with your feet hip-width apart and slowly bend forward at the waist, reaching your hands towards your toes. Hold for 10-20 seconds, then slowly roll back up to standing.
  • Downward dog: Start on your hands and knees, then lift your hips up towards the ceiling, straightening your arms and legs. Hold for 10-20 seconds, then release.
  • Cobra pose: Lie on your stomach with your hands under your shoulders. Slowly lift your chest up off the ground, keeping your elbows close to your body. Hold for 10-20 seconds, then release.

Step-by-Step Guide to Morning Stretching

If you're new to stretching or want to create a more structured routine, here's a step-by-step guide to morning stretching:
  1. Start by taking a few deep breaths, inhaling through your nose and exhaling through your mouth. This can help calm your mind and prepare your body for stretching.
  2. Begin with some gentle neck stretches, such as slowly tilting your head to the side and holding for a few seconds, then repeating on the other side.
  3. Move on to shoulder rolls, rolling your shoulders forward and backward several times to release tension in your upper body.
  4. Next, do some standing stretches, such as the forward fold or the lunge stretch.
  5. Finish with some seated stretches, such as the butterfly stretch or the seated forward bend.
  6. Take a few more deep breaths and then slowly stand up, feeling energized and ready to start your day.

Tips for Effective Morning Stretching

To get the most out of your morning stretching routine, here are some tips to keep in mind:
  • Start slowly and gently, especially if you're new to stretching or haven't done it in a while.
  • Breathe deeply and evenly throughout each stretch, inhaling as you lengthen your muscles and exhaling as you release.
  • Don't force any stretches or push yourself too hard, as this can lead to injury.
  • Pay attention to your body and how each stretch feels, adjusting as needed to find the right level of intensity.
  • Make stretching a regular part of your morning routine, and try to do it at the same time each day.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can stretching help me wake up if I didn't get enough sleep?

While stretching can help wake you up and give you a burst of energy, it's not a substitute for getting enough sleep. If you're consistently not getting enough sleep, you may need to adjust your sleep habits in order to feel more rested and alert in the morning.

How long should I stretch for in the morning?

There's no set amount of time that's best for morning stretching, as it will depend on your individual needs and preferences. Some people may find that a few minutes of stretching is all they need to feel energized, while others may prefer a longer, more extensive stretching routine.
